Escobar: Russia–Iran–China – All For One, And One For All?

April 12, 2025No Comments2 Mins Read
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Email
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

Pepe Escobar, writing for The Cradle, discusses the significant geopolitical developments in the Eurasia integration process, with Russia and Iran leading the way as top members of BRICS+ and the Shanghai Cooperation Organization. The two countries have recently signed a comprehensive strategic partnership, showcasing their commitment to building a multi-nodal, multipolar world.

The article highlights the tensions between the US, under President Trump’s administration, and Russia and Iran. Despite Trump’s “maximum pressure” tactics, Russia and Iran are adamant about not accepting threats of bombing Iran’s nuclear and energy infrastructure. The narrative shifts as US Special Envoy for Middle East Affairs, Steven Witkoff, begins talking about confidence-building and resolving disagreements, signaling a potential for indirect nuclear talks.

The piece delves into the details of the Russia-Iran-China axis, emphasizing the strategic partnership between the three countries. While not a formal alliance, the trilateral synergy is evident in joint naval exercises and deepening cooperation. The article also touches on the delicate balance in Russia’s relations with countries like Yemen and Lebanon, as well as the complexities of the Syrian conflict.

The author explores the dynamics of the Russia-Iran treaty and the broader implications for regional stability. As Trump considers a possible deal involving Russia to pivot towards Iran, the article underscores the importance of dialogue, non-escalation, and mutual confidence-building in addressing the nuclear issue.

The article concludes by highlighting the upcoming summit between Russian President Vladimir Putin and Chinese President Xi Jinping, where they will discuss the changing geopolitical landscape and potential challenges ahead. The author warns against the risks of escalating tensions in the region and emphasizes the need for diplomatic solutions to avoid catastrophic consequences.

Overall, the article provides a nuanced analysis of the evolving geopolitical dynamics in Eurasia, emphasizing the importance of cooperation and dialogue in maintaining stability and peace in the region.
